On some of the forums guys are saying they rent their truck from Enterprise. They’re paying a straight 22 cents per mile and turning them in at 60,000 miles and getting another one. Advantages are no hit to your credit report and you get a new truck every 60k. Just something to think about. Drive safe and good luck.
I actually started doing hotshot with one of those. It’s a pretty solid option. Unfortunately for them, they are running very low with inventory. It’s getting harder and harder to get into their program and then get a new truck when the time is right.
